Diagnostic Enzyme Procurement Checklist for IVD Reagent Plants

For a diagnostic reagent manufacturer, enzyme procurement is not a spot buy. It is a controlled supply decision that affects QC release, lot-to-lot performance, documentation workload, and finished-kit continuity.

1. Confirm fit with your reagent architecture

Before price comparison, confirm that the enzyme is compatible with the way your reagent is formulated, filled, stored, and released.

Evaluate:

  • Compatibility with your buffer system and stabilizer package
  • Performance after exposure to your filling and hold conditions
  • Behavior in liquid, lyophilized, or dry-blended reagent formats
  • Tolerance to preservatives, salts, surfactants, and excipients in your matrix
  • Stability profile across your intended shelf-life model
  • Suitability for pilot, validation, and commercial batch sizes

A qualified supplier should understand that enzyme performance is matrix-dependent. A material that looks acceptable in isolation can behave differently inside a finished reagent.

2. Require lot-to-lot consistency evidence

Lot consistency is central to diagnostic reagent manufacturing. Procurement should request evidence that the supplier controls variation before material reaches your QC team.

Ask for:

  • Lot history for comparable bulk supply
  • Defined release specifications
  • COA format review before purchase
  • Retention sample policy
  • Trend visibility across critical quality attributes
  • Clear escalation paths for deviations

Consistency reduces investigation time. It also protects validated formulations from avoidable drift.

3. Review documentation before qualification

Documentation gaps create delays during supplier qualification, internal approval, and regulatory file maintenance. Request the document set early.

Typical documentation may include:

  • Certificate of Analysis
  • Safety Data Sheet
  • Product specification sheet
  • Origin and manufacturing statement where applicable
  • Allergen, animal-origin, or relevant risk statements where applicable
  • Change-control policy
  • Shelf-life and storage guidance
  • Packaging and labeling information
  • Quality questionnaire support

4. Verify bulk packaging and handling alignment

Packaging can affect usability at the plant level. The right bulk format helps receiving, sampling, dispensing, and inventory control.

Check:

  • Container size options for pilot and production lots
  • Closure integrity and tamper-evident requirements
  • Label information needed by your receiving team
  • Temperature-controlled shipping needs
  • Batch traceability from shipment to internal lot assignment
  • Handling instructions for thaw, mix, aliquot, or reclose steps where relevant

Bulk supply should reduce operational friction, not create new handling risk.

5. Assess lead times and forecast support

Diagnostic reagent plants need continuity. A technically acceptable enzyme is not sufficient if supply timing is unpredictable.

Confirm:

  • Standard lead-time range for routine orders
  • Planning requirements for larger campaigns
  • Safety-stock or reserved-lot options
  • Forecast communication cadence
  • Minimum order expectations
  • Expedited supply feasibility
  • Regional shipping considerations

Procurement teams should know when to order, what can be reserved, and how the supplier communicates risk.

6. Clarify change-control expectations

Uncontrolled supplier changes can create expensive downstream work. Your enzyme supplier should define how changes are reviewed and communicated.

Ask about notification for changes involving:

  • Manufacturing site or process
  • Raw material source
  • Specification or release criteria
  • Packaging configuration
  • Storage recommendation
  • Documentation format
  • Discontinuation or replacement material

Change-control support helps maintain validated reagent performance and internal quality records.

7. Align technical support with plant realities

Support should be practical. Diagnostic reagent manufacturers need fast, specific answers that help them make supply decisions.

Useful supplier support includes:

  • Compatibility discussion for the intended reagent matrix
  • Guidance on pilot-to-production scale transition
  • Review of stability and handling constraints
  • Support during incoming QC questions
  • Document clarification for supplier qualification
  • Root-cause communication if an issue is detected

The goal is not generic technical literature. The goal is material that fits your manufacturing process and release workflow.

8. Compare total procurement value, not only unit price

Low purchase price can become expensive if it increases QC burden, deviation handling, reformulation work, or inventory risk.

When comparing suppliers, include:

  • Lot acceptance rate
  • Documentation completeness
  • Forecast reliability
  • Communication speed
  • Change-control discipline
  • Packaging fit
  • Reorder consistency
  • Technical responsiveness

A stable supplier relationship protects production schedules and reduces hidden cost.

Quick checklist for supplier qualification

Use this list during RFQ review:

  • Enzyme fits the intended reagent matrix
  • Bulk format supports pilot and production needs
  • COA and specification format are acceptable
  • Lot traceability is clear
  • Shelf-life and storage guidance are documented
  • Retention sample policy is available
  • Lead times match production planning
  • Change-control process is defined
  • Quality questionnaire support is available
  • Technical contact is available for compatibility questions
  • Commercial contact understands forecasts and repeat supply
